Quick Assessment
This early reader nonfiction book introduces young children ages 5-8 to famous explorers and their adventures, blending history with engaging travel stories. It includes supportive features like timelines, maps, and thought-provoking questions to encourage curiosity and learning about exploration. The content is age-appropriate, with no intense themes, ideal for early elementary readers interested in history and discovery.
